Code P1569 Volkswagen Description

OBDII Code P1569 Volkswagen - Switch For CCS Signal Faulty - AutoCodes.com
P1569 Volkswagen Code - Switch For CCS Signal Faulty

What are the Possible Causes of the DTC P1569 Volkswagen?

  • Faulty Cruise Control System (CCS) Switch
  • Cruise Control System (CCS) Switch harness is open or shorted
  • Cruise Control System (CCS) Switch circuit poor electrical connection

How to Fix the DTC P1569 Volkswagen?

Review the 'Possible Causes' above and visually examine the corresponding wiring harness and connectors. Check for damaged components and inspect connector pins for signs of being broken, bent, pushed out, or corroded.

What is the Cost to Diagnose the Code?

Labor: 1.0

To diagnose the P1569 Volkswagen code, it typically requires 1.0 hour of labor. Rates vary by location, vehicle, and shop. Many shops charge between $80–$150 per hour; dealerships and metro areas may be higher, independents may be lower.

Frequently Asked Questions about P1569 Volkswagen Code

1. What does the OBDII code P1569 mean for a Volkswagen?

P1569 indicates a fault with the switch for the Cruise Control System (CCS), signaling an issue in its functionality or communication.

2. What are the symptoms of code P1569 in a Volkswagen?

Common symptoms include the cruise control not engaging, intermittent functionality, or the cruise control system being completely disabled.

3. What could cause the P1569 code in a Volkswagen?

Possible causes include a faulty cruise control switch, damaged wiring, poor electrical connections, or issues with the CCS module.

4. Can driving with code P1569 damage my Volkswagen?

Driving with this code typically won't harm the vehicle, but it may limit cruise control functionality, affecting driving convenience.

5. How do I diagnose the P1569 code on my Volkswagen?

Diagnose the code by checking the cruise control switch, inspecting wiring for damage, and testing electrical connections with a multimeter.

6. How can I fix the P1569 code in a Volkswagen?

Repairs may involve replacing the cruise control switch, repairing damaged wiring, or cleaning corroded electrical connectors.

7. Is the P1569 code specific to certain Volkswagen models?

This code can appear in various Volkswagen models equipped with cruise control, as long as an issue exists with the CCS switch or related circuitry.

8. How much does it typically cost to fix the P1569 code?

Repair costs vary but may range from $50 to $300, depending on whether the cruise control switch or wiring needs replacement.

9. Can I clear the P1569 code without fixing the issue?

Clearing the code without addressing the root cause may temporarily remove it, but the code will likely return once the issue persists.

10. What tools are needed to repair the P1569 code on a Volkswagen?

Basic tools include a diagnostic scanner, multimeter, and possibly a screwdriver or trim removal tools to access the cruise control switch.
